thymeleaf模板实现html5标签的非严格检查
2018-02-24 14:48
441 查看
一、概述
最近在springboot项目引入thymeleaf模板时,使用非严格标签时,运行会报错。默认thymeleaf模板对html5标签是严格检查的。二、在项目中加NekoHTML库
在Maven中添加依赖<dependency><groupId>net.sourceforge.nekohtml</groupId>
<artifactId>nekohtml</artifactId>
<version>1.9.22</version>
</dependency>
三、更改thymeleaf设置
在配置文件application.properties中,对thymeleaf模板设置。LEGACYHTML5需要搭配NekoHTML库才可用,实现thymeleaf非严格检查。#thymeleaf
spring.thymeleaf.encoding=UTF-8
spring.thymeleaf.suffix=.html
#默认严格检查
#spring.thymeleaf.mode=HTML5
#非严格检查
spring.thymeleaf.mode=LEGACYHTML5
相关文章推荐
- Thymeleaf模板HTML5没有结束标签解决办法
- thymeleaf模板对没有结束符的HTML5标签解析出错的解决办法
- 当使用thymeleaf模板检查太过严格的解决办法
- thymeleaf模板对没有结束符的HTML5标签解析出错的解决办法
- thymeleaf模板对没有结束符的HTML5标签解析出错的解决办法
- html5:<canvas>标签实现动态效果
- 使用HTML5 select标签来实现更改网页背景颜色
- web项目引用html5 video标签实现视频播放的坑
- 使用HTML5的Canvas标签实现绘图板内拖拽元素
- HTML5 中的 canvas 标签 实现动画效果
- html5:<canvas>标签实现动态效果
- HTML5 audio与video标签实现视频播放,音频播放
- HTML5使用Audio标签实现歌词同步的效果
- transform实现HTML5 video标签视频比例拉伸实例详解
- HTML5 canvas标签实现刮刮卡效果
- HTML5 audio与video标签实现视频播放,音频播放
- 利用HTML5的canvas标签实现灰太狼图像的绘制
- springboot开发日志(3): thymeleaf模板标签不闭合报错
- android--------WebView实现 Html5 视频标签加载
- HTML5 audio与video标签实现视频播放,音频播放